Составные части циклической управляющей структуры алгоритма являются итерация и условие.
Когда я пишу алгоритмы, мне часто нужно выполнять одну и ту же последовательность действий множество раз. Для этого я использую циклическую управляющую структуру. Цикл позволяет мне повторять определенный блок кода до тех пор, пока выполняется определенное условие.Существует несколько типов циклов, но в данной статье я расскажу о самом распространенном ౼ цикле с предусловием. Верно утверждение, что составными частями циклической управляющей структуры алгоритма являются итерация (повторение блока кода) и условие (проверка условия для продолжения цикла).Пример псевдокода, демонстрирующего цикл с предусловием в языке программирования Python⁚
while условие⁚
# блок кода, который будет выполняться, пока условие истинно
Давайте представим, что мы пишем программу для подсчета суммы последовательности чисел, пока сумма не превысит 100. Вот как это можно сделать с помощью цикла с предусловием⁚
python
сумма 0
число 1
while сумма < 100⁚
сумма число
число 1
print(″Сумма⁚″, сумма)
В этом примере, пока сумма чисел меньше или равна 100, мы добавляем число к сумме и увеличиваем число на 1. Когда сумма превысит 100, цикл завершится и мы выведем итоговую сумму.
Циклическая управляющая структура алгоритма является мощным инструментом, который помогает автоматизировать повторяющиеся действия и сократить количество кода. Правильное понимание составных частей циклической структуры поможет вам создавать более эффективные и легко читаемые программы.